India has clarified reporting details for the controversial 1% tax deducted at source (TDS) for digital asset transactions, which is set to kick in on July 1. By amitoj
India's Finance Ministry has issued guidelines to clarify the reporting mechanism for the contentious and soon-to-be-implemented 1% tax deducted at source provision.The 1% TDS liability – which will take effect on July 1 – is the most controversial provision of India’s recently introduced crypto tax law, with the industry even exploring a. Another provision, which enforces a 30% capital gains tax on all crypto transactions, took effect on April 1.
The format to report the transaction was also specified by the government. A new form will be introduced entitled 26QE, which will play the dual role of a statement and a receipt. The tax would have to be paid beforehand in cases where the payment for the transfer of a digital asset is in kind.
